
Learning and Development Program
Overview
The Learning and Development Program at DOSO Safespace is a comprehensive capacity-building initiative designed to equip students, individuals, community leaders, and organizations with practical skills for personal growth, career advancement, and organizational effectiveness.
As a nonprofit organization, DOSO Safespace believes that sustainable impact is achieved when people are empowered with knowledge, skills, and guidance that respond to real-life challenges. This program combines training, mentorship, and career guidance to support participants at different stages of their academic, professional, and leadership journeys.
Some trainings are offered free as part of our community service mission, while others are paid and customized, enabling deeper engagement and program sustainability.

Core Program Areas
1. Project, Proposal, and Grant Writing
We help individuals and organizations develop strong, fundable proposals by strengthening both technical writing skills and strategic planning capacity. Participants learn how to:
- Identify suitable funding opportunities
- Design clear, impactful projects
- Write competitive proposals aligned with donor priorities
- Develop realistic budgets and implementation plans
- Track outcomes and reporting requirements
2. Fundraising and Resource Mobilization
This component focuses on ethical and sustainable fundraising strategies that support long-term organizational growth. Participants gain skills to:
- Design and implement fundraising plans
- Communicate impact effectively to donors
- Diversify funding sources and partnerships
- Use digital fundraising tools responsibly
- Build trust-based donor relationships
3. Leadership Development
Our leadership development training emphasizes values-driven and inclusive leadership. Participants learn to:
- Understand and apply different leadership styles
- Build emotional intelligence and self-awareness
- Strengthen communication, teamwork, and decision-making
- Lead with integrity, accountability, and service
- Navigate leadership challenges in diverse environments
4. Digital Literacy and Technology Skills
We equip participants with essential digital skills for academic, professional, and organizational success. Training covers:
- Effective use of digital tools for learning and work
- Safe and responsible internet use
- Digital communication and online collaboration
- Technology for organizational management and outreach
- Basic digital research and information management
5. Financial Literacy and Financial Management
This area focuses on responsible financial practices at both personal and organizational levels. Participants learn how to:
- Manage personal finances and budgets
- Understand basic financial records and reporting
- Practice transparency and accountability
- Plan for financial sustainability
- Strengthen financial decision-making skills
6. Time Management and Productivity
Time management training supports participants in balancing multiple responsibilities while maintaining well-being. Topics include:
- Goal setting and prioritization
- Planning and organizing tasks effectively
- Managing deadlines and workloads
- Reducing stress and burnout
- Developing healthy productivity habits
7. Career Guidance and Professional Development
Career guidance is a key component of the Learning and Development Program, particularly for students and early-career professionals. This component supports participants in making informed, confident career decisions. Participants receive guidance on:
- Identifying career interests, strengths, and goals
- Understanding career pathways in nonprofit, corporate, and social impact sectors
- Academic and professional planning
- Resume and cover letter development
- Interview preparation and professional communication
- Navigating transitions from education to employment or leadership roles
Our career guidance approach emphasizes purpose, skills alignment, and long-term growth, helping participants build meaningful and sustainable careers.
How the Program Works
Step 1: Inquiry and Needs Assessment
Individuals or organizations begin by contacting DOSO Safespace through our website or direct communication. We assess their needs, goals, and context to recommend appropriate training or guidance.
Step 2: Program Design
Based on the assessment, DOSO Safespace designs:
- One-time workshops or seminars
- Multi-session training programs
- Customized organizational capacity-building support
- Group or one-on-one career guidance sessions
Programs may be delivered in person or online, depending on location and availability.
Step 3: Training and Engagement
Sessions are interactive and practice-oriented, incorporating discussions, exercises, real-life examples, and reflection. Participants are encouraged to actively engage and apply their learning immediately.
Step 4: Follow-Up and Support
Where possible, participants receive follow-up support, learning resources, or mentorship to help them implement skills and continue growing.
